Hi,

 

Users will get the yellow exclamation mark on the system tray icon if some of the functions in Protection are off. That is to say, the free version will have the yellow exclamation mark on the tray icon of the program.

 

However, it is highly recommended to activate the Pro version of the program and get all the functions available and protect the computer in a comprehensive way. So the exclamation mark on the system tray icon is to kindly remind the users to get the computer fully protected. Thanks for your understanding.
